puzzle with the national flag of bahrain and yemen on a world map background.No description available
puzzle with the national flag of bahrain and austria on a world map backgrounNo description available
puzzle with the national flag of bahrain and sri lanka on a world map backgroNo description available
puzzle with the national flag of bahrain and argentina on a world map backgroNo description available
Soccer ball with the United Arab Emirates flag on the green grass against bluNo description available
Digital illustration of the flag of Bahrain waving against a bright yellow skNo description available